Tips for Choosing a Name

1. Understand the Cultural and Linguistic Context

A name carries deep cultural and linguistic meaning. Some names might have different meanings in various languages, so it’s important to research before choosing. A name that sounds elegant in one culture may have an unintended meaning in another.

2. Think About How It Sounds

Pronunciation and flow matter. Say the name out loud and see if it sounds pleasant. Avoid names that are difficult to pronounce or might cause confusion. A name with a smooth and natural rhythm often feels more appealing.

3. Consider the Future

A name should grow with the person. What sounds cute for a child should also work well for an adult. Think about how it will look on a résumé, in professional settings, or in different life stages.

4. Find Personal Connections

A meaningful name is always special. Choose a name that connects to heritage, family history, a favorite place, or a beloved memory. This makes the name unique and full of emotional value.

5. Reflect on Its Bearer

Consider how the name reflects the person’s personality, traits, or aspirations. Some names sound strong, elegant, playful, or mysterious. Pick one that matches the vibe you want to convey.

6. Seek Input

Getting feedback from family and friends can be helpful. Sometimes, others might notice things you didn’t. However, make sure the final choice is something you truly love and feel comfortable with.
